Operational Risks Enterprises Underestimate During Migration

Enterprises often focus on tools and timelines. They ignore operational reality. This creates real enterprise cloud migration risks.

Downtime can break mission-critical workflows. Customer-facing apps lose transactions. Internal workflows stop approvals and dispatch. So, teams must protect business continuity during migration.

Migration also impacts teams and culture. People resist change when they fear instability. Stakeholders ask for guarantees. Teams also push back when they see unclear ownership. These human risks slow enterprise IT transformation.

Skills also matter. Cloud migrations need architects, security specialists, and DevOps engineers. Many teams face cloud skill gaps. That gap slows execution and increases errors.

Cost & Governance Gaps That Surface Post-Migration

When enterprises celebrate “migration complete”, the reality hits hard later! They confront cost spikes and unclear controls.

Without discipline, cloud costs rise quickly. Overprovisioned compute, idle resources, and unused licenses waste budgets. That makes enterprise cloud cost management essential.

Flexera also highlights that organizations exceed cloud budgets by 17% on average, mainly due to weak forecasting and control.

 

Enterprises also need cloud governance for enterprises. They must define who owns budgets, access, and policies. They must control resource creation and prevent shadow IT.

Regulated industries also face cloud compliance challenges. They need data residency controls, encryption standards, and audit-ready logs. Without these controls, risk increases after migration.

IBM reports that 64% of executives say industry regulations block or slow cloud adoption.

Ownership also becomes unclear. Teams migrate apps but do not assign operational responsibility. That creates gaps in patching, monitoring, and optimization.

A Practical Framework to Migrate Enterprise Application to Cloud with Confidence

Step 1

Decide What to Migrate, Not Everything Belongs in the Cloud First

Organizations rush to migrate everything. That approach adds risk. A smarter plan starts with an enterprise application portfolio assessment.

Start by classifying apps by business impact and technical complexity. Identify apps that support revenue, customer experience, and compliance. Also identify apps that support internal workflows and reporting.

Next, run a cloud migration readiness assessment. Review architecture, performance needs, data sensitivity, and dependency depth. This step prevents surprises.

Then apply application rationalization. Some apps need modernization. Some apps need replacement. Some apps should retire. This reduces workload and cost.

You also avoid legacy system modernization risks by setting realistic priorities. Pick apps that deliver value early. Do not start with the most complex system unless business forces the move.

This step helps you migrate enterprise application to cloud with clarity, not chaos.

Step 2

Match the Right Migration Strategy to Each Application (6R Model)

One-size approach does not work. You must match enterprise application migration strategies to each workload. The 6R model helps teams choose wisely.

Here’s how cloud migration strategies for enterprises usually map:

Rehost for speed. You move workloads fast with limited change.

Replatform for efficiency. You optimize runtime and services without full rewrite.

Replace when SaaS provides better fit.

Retire apps that no longer deliver value.

Refactor for scalability. You redesign parts for cloud-native scale.

Retain apps that face regulatory, latency, or dependency constraints.

Companies often compare rehost, replatform, and refactor applications to decide. Rehost helps quick wins. Replatform improves cost and ops. Refactor drives agility but needs investment.

A good migration plan also considers re-engineering vs refactoring enterprise applications. Refactoring improves specific components. Re-engineering changes architecture at deeper levels.

When teams use the right model, they migrate enterprise application to cloud with better speed and fewer trade-offs.

Step 3

Build Cloud Architecture and Security Before You Migrate

Architecture sets the foundation for safe migration. So, organizations must define enterprise cloud architecture early.

Start with landing zones, network segmentation, and workload placement rules. Plan for high availability and disaster recovery. These decisions protect business-critical systems.

Security also needs strong design. Implement cloud security for enterprise applications with least privilege access. Use role-based access and strong MFA.

Microsoft research shows that MFA blocks more than 99.2% of account compromise attacks.

 

Define identity and access management cloud controls. Centralize identity. Enforce conditional access. Control privileged accounts. These actions stop unauthorized access.

Protect data with encryption, key management, and logging. Apply strong enterprise data security in cloud across storage and databases.

Also follow enterprise cloud security best practices. Use automated policy checks. Monitor threat signals. Integrate SIEM tools. Security becomes easier when you bake it into architecture.

This step makes it safer to migrate enterprise application to cloud at scale.

Step 4

Execute Migration Without Disrupting Business Operations

Execution makes or breaks migration outcomes! Yes, you heard right! The secret to your goal is stability. Being stable focuses on enterprise cloud migration execution with minimal disruption.

Start with pilot migrations. Pick a controlled workload first. Validate tools, patterns, and governance. This process reduces risk for larger systems.

Secondly, plan enterprise workload migration in phases. Group the applications by dependency chains. Move supporting services with the core workload. Avoid splitting critical integrations across timelines.

Run parallel operations when needed. Use blue-green deployment patterns. Keep rollback options ready. This protects production workflows and customer experience.

Use strong application migration testing. Run performance tests, security tests, and regression tests. Validate API integrations and data consistency.

Follow proven cloud migration best practices. Use automation for infrastructure deployment. Use IaC templates. Use CI/CD for releases.

A clear plan aligned to cloud migration execution best practices helps teams migrate with control and protect business uptime. It also helps you migrate enterprise application to cloud without breaking operations.

How Enterprises Reduce Risk While Migrating Applications to the Cloud

Enterprises reduce disruption when they plan for controlled progress. A low-risk cloud migration for enterprises starts with the right sequencing.

Start with low-complexity workloads first. Pick apps with fewer integrations and lower data sensitivity. Use them to validate your approach.

Adopt a phased cloud migration approach. Move in waves based on dependencies and business criticality. Keep clear rollback options ready.

Use a hybrid cloud migration strategy when needed. Keep latency-sensitive systems on-prem while you migrate supporting services to cloud. This balances performance and flexibility.

Build an enterprise migration roadmap with milestones, testing checkpoints, and sign-offs.

Follow a well-architected cloud migration approach. Design for reliability, security, and cost control from the start.

These steps keep business operations stable while you migrate enterprise application to cloud.

FAQs

What should enterprises evaluate before they migrate enterprise application to cloud?

Enterprises evaluate application criticality, dependencies, data sensitivity, and performance needs. They also assess cloud readiness across architecture, security, cost, and operations.

Why do enterprise cloud migrations fail to deliver expected business value?

Enterprises fail when they treat migration as lift-and-shift and skip modernization. Weak governance and poor cost control also reduce business value.

Which enterprise applications should be migrated first to the cloud?

Enterprises migrate low-complexity apps with fewer integrations and low risk first. They prioritize workloads that deliver quick wins and validate cloud patterns.

How do enterprises choose the right migration strategy for each application?

Enterprises use the 6R model and match strategy to business goals and technical constraints. They select rehost for speed, replatform for efficiency, and refactor for scalability.

How can enterprises migrate applications to the cloud without disrupting operations?

Enterprises execute migration in phases and run pilots before full rollout. They use parallel runs, rollback plans, and strong testing to protect uptime.

Is cloud migration alone enough for long-term enterprise scalability?

Cloud migration improves infrastructure flexibility, but it does not guarantee scalability. Enterprises also modernize applications to achieve true agility and performance.

How can enterprises control costs after migrating applications to the cloud?

Enterprises apply FinOps practices like tagging, budgeting, and usage monitoring. They also right-size workloads and remove idle resources continuously.
